Mark Battistella welcomes support for KeychainKit through GitHub Sponsors, paypal.me, paypal.me, and paypal.me. If you find this package useful, please consider supporting it.
When working with an Xcode project:
When working with a Swift Package Manager manifest:
Select a package version:
25.11.21
main
KeychainKit is a Swift package that provides a clean, type-safe, and extensible API for securely storing, retrieving, and managing values in the system Keychain. It supports primitives, collections, Codable types, synchronisation options, accessibility controls, and automated migration between service names and access groups.